In Mcleod, the housing market operates on a different scale than in major cities. You might be looking at a charming single-family home on a larger lot, a property with agricultural potential, or a fixer-upper that holds generations of history. A local or regional home loan company with experience in Ransom County brings invaluable insight. They understand the appraised value of outbuildings, acreage, and wells in a way that a national, algorithm-driven lender might not. This local expertise is critical for a smooth appraisal and approval process, ensuring the true value of your Mcleod property is recognized.

Speaking of programs, North Dakota offers fantastic resources that a knowledgeable local lender can help you navigate. The North Dakota Housing Finance Agency (NDHFA) provides several first-time homebuyer programs, including down payment and closing cost assistance, and affordable mortgage rates. These programs have income and purchase price limits, which in a Mcleod context are often more attainable than in urban areas, making them a powerful tool for eligible buyers. A lender familiar with NDHFA's process can be a huge advantage.
Here is your actionable plan: First, make a shortlist of three to four lenders: a local community bank, a regional credit union, and one or two recommended regional mortgage companies. Ask each one specific questions: "What is your experience with properties on private wells and septic systems in Ransom County?" and "Can you walk me through the NDHFA programs I might qualify for?" Compare not just interest rates, but also closing cost estimates and the responsiveness of the loan officer.
